| Distrito de Leiria | Nazare or anywhere? Posted: Mon June 13, 2005 05:22 PM UTC
I was going to have Nazare as my base for visiting Obidos, Alcobaca and the rest of the region, to enjoy both the Atlantic and the monuments. However, I cannot find any nice accommodation there (yes, I read the Nazare accommodation question on the forum, but I’m looking for something with more of an ambience) .
Can anybody suggest either a different starting point in the region (preferably a nice seaside village) or accommodation in Nazare? I’m going to be using public transportation, so I’m looking for a place with train/bus access. Thanks for all your tips! |

| Distrito de Leiria | RE: Nazare or anywhere? Posted: Mon June 13, 2005 07:38 PM UTC
You could choose Leiria as a base to visit Batalha and Alcobaca. Leiria is not on the sea, but it is a nice town.
Obidos should not be far from Leiria too. I also suggest a short stay in Tomar.

| Distrito de Leiria | RE: Nazare or anywhere? Posted: Tue June 14, 2005 09:04 AM UTC
If you're looking for a nice seaside place, Nazaré isn't the right choice. It's an ugly village with nothing to see. It was quite nice until the 80's.
Try Caldas da Rainha (not seaside but quite close) or Peniche.
